Hello, I plugged my Midway Wolf board directly into the HAS, with regenerated sync enabled, into my OSSC. The latter doesn't detect any signal whatsoever. When regenerated sync is off the OSSC picks up the signal immediately. Is there any tweaks I can do so I can use my board with regenerated sync on?
 
I wrote about what you need to do to make Midway Y/T/Wolf games work.

Regeneration sync isn't compatible.
You need a iScan DVDO VP30-50-50pro to process the sync from the OSSC for a display to pick it up.

Having recently needing to do this for JP pcs:
image0.jpg

go into sampling opt. > Adv. timing and press ok
scroll down to v. backporch this sets the vertical top of the image -
from 18 to 39 now it’s cut off on the bottom however the top of our screen is in line with the monitor so switch to v active
image0.jpg


since mine was cut off i ramped v active to much higher - from 480 to 530 just so i could get the full image... note image does not update unless you toggle backporch up/down one
image0.jpg


but now v. active is too high so the trick is to lower v active while watching the image
you'll see the bottom line of the image instantly vanish - that's the full size of your image
i.e switching from 512 to 511 the bottom row is lost... if i leave to 512 and go back to backporch and flip it once up/down.....
image0.jpg

screen fits :)
